TISHA B'AV
Tisha B'Av (the 9th of Av) is an annual fast day which commemorates the anniversary of a number of disasters in Jewish history, primarily the destruction of both the First Temple by the Babylonians and the Second Temple by the Romans. The tradition is to read from Megillat Eichah (the book of Lamentations) and to recite special psalms of mourning (kinot).
